MANILA, Philippines—Like fellow San Miguel Beer teammates June Mar Fajardo and CJ Perez, rest will have to wait for Jericho Cruz as he shifts focus on being part of Guam’s maiden appearance in the Fiba Asia Cup.

Cruz left for Jeddah, Saudi Arabia over the weekend as he looks to give Guam a respectable showing amid a difficult task in the continental tournament.

“Here comes Guam. Time to represent,” Cruz said on his Instagram account.

The 34-year-old is coming off a memorable role in San Miguel Beer’s run to the PBA Philippine Cup crown that saw him being named the Finals Most Valuable Player.

Guam is hoping that Cruz can carry that form into the Asia Cup where it will face Japan, Iran and Syria in Group B.

Its first game is on Wednesday against Iran before facing Syria on Saturday and Japan on Sunday.

Article continues after this advertisement

“That’s where we can see where the caliber of Team Guam is,” Cruz said in a feature posted on the tournament’s official page.

Guam qualified the hard way after placing second in the final qualifying tournament last March in Taipei.
